What is the past tense of dehydrate?

What's the past tense of dehydrate? Here's the word you're looking for.

Answer

The past tense of dehydrate is dehydrated.

The third-person singular simple present indicative form of dehydrate is dehydrates.

The present participle of dehydrate is dehydrating.

The past participle of dehydrate is dehydrated.
